Ta Prohm Temple, Cambodia

Ta Prohm Temple, Siem Reap, Cambodia

Ta Prohm is the modern name of a temple at Angkor, Siem Reap Province, Cambodia, built in the late 12th and early 13th centuries and originally called Rajavihara. UNESCO inscribed it on the World Heritage List in 1992. The trees growing out of the ruins are perhaps the most distinctive feature of Ta Prohm.
